Objective: This study aims to identify the intellectual structure and key trends of research related to schools and autism by analyzing the key terms in these studies. Method: The data were analyzed using the NetMiner program to conduct a social network analysis of the key terms. Results: As a research data, 294 studies with the keyword ‘school-autism’ were selected from the Korean Citation Index (KCI) from September 2003 to September 2023 for analysis. The study results showed that 94 studies were published in the past 10 years, and 200 in the most recent 10 years, indicating an increase in the quantity of research. Keywords with high degree centrality included student (0.083), intervention (0.067), school (0.047), behavior (0.040), and autism (0.041). Significant thematic changes in the research were not identified. Conclusion: The trends in school-autism research from 2003 to 2023 showed little change. Furthermore, the social network analysis effectively captured the key terms and research trends related to ‘school-autism.’ It is expected that the findings of this study can serve as a reference for academic research and policy development.
